body {background-repeat:repeat; background-color:#000099; background-position:left top; font-family:Arial, Helvetica, sans-serif; font-size:80%;margin:0; padding:0;}
#d3top {  background-image:url(../images/instop.gif); background-repeat:no-repeat; background-position: left top; height:149px;}

/*begin nav*/
#navcontainer {width: 180px; margin:0; padding-bottom: 0; position: absolute; padding-top: 2%; left: 0px; letter-spacing:1px;	font-size: 100%; }

#navcontainer .d3mlong {	font-weight:bold; height: 25px; width:97%; background-image: url(../images/insredbak.gif);	background-repeat: repeat;	color: #ffFFFF;	text-align: left;	text-indent: 10px; margin-top:6px; margin-bottom:6px;	padding-top: 6px; border: 2px solid  #666666;} 
.d3mlong A:link {text-decoration: none; color:#ffffff;}
.d3mlong A:visited {text-decoration: none; color:#ffffff;}
.d3mlong A:active {text-decoration: none; color:#ffffff; }
.d3mlong A:hover {text-decoration: underline overline; color: #FFFF00;}

#navcontainer ul {margin-left: 0;padding-left: 0;list-style-type: none;}

#llogo { background-color:#660000; height: 40px;  background-image: url(../images/iinsaglogo.gif); background-repeat: no-repeat; background-position: center top;}

#content { margin-left:184px; width:80%;  background-color:#FFFFFF; padding: 6px; }
#content h1 {font-family: Times New Roman, Times, serif; text-align:center; font-size: 300%; color:#d20000; padding-bottom:1em;}
#content h2 {font-family: Times New Roman, Times, serif; font-size: 180%; padding-bottom:.15em; border-bottom: 1px solid #d20000; color:#000033;}
#content p { padding-left: 3%;}
#content img {margin-left:10px; margin-right:10px; margin-bottom:20px;}
#content .agentname { font-size:95%; font-weight:bold; color: #000066; text-align:left; padding-top:5%;}
#content .agenttitle { font-weight:bold; color: #666666; text-align:left; }
#content .agentinfo { font-size: 100%; color: #000000; text-align:left; }
 A:link {text-decoration: none; color: #990000;}
 A:visited {text-decoration: none; color: #990000;}
 A:active {text-decoration: none; color:#990000; }
 A:hover {text-decoration: underline; color:#990000;}
#content .agentbiohead {font-family: Times New Roman, Times, serif; font-size:175%; font-weight:bold; color: #660000; text-align:left; line-height: 1em;}
#content .agentbio {font-size:100%; color: #000000; text-align:left; }

div.tuscola {float: right; width: 400px; border: 8px white solid;margin-right:3%;}
div.tuscola p {text-align: center; font-style: italic; font-size: 83%; text-indent: 0;}

div.vg {float: right; width: 297px; border: 8px white solid; margin-right:3%;}
div.vg p {text-align: center; font-style: italic; font-size: 83%; text-indent: 0;}

#footer { margin-left:184px; font-size:85%; width:80%; text-align:center;  background-color:#FFFFFF; padding: 6px; padding-top: 4%; }

#footer .admin { font-size:65%; padding-top:1%;}
